<h2 id="heading-1-focusing-too-much-on-design-not-enough-on-strategy"><strong>1. Focusing Too Much on Design, Not Enough on Strategy</strong></h2>
<p>It’s easy to get carried away with colors, fonts, and animations. But none of that matters if your website doesn’t clearly tell people what you do and how you can help them.</p>
<p>What to do instead:</p>
<ul>
<li><p>Define the goal of your website (e.g., get leads, make sales, book appointments).</p>
</li>
<li><p>Place that goal front and center on your home page.</p>
</li>
<li><p>Use clean layouts that guide the visitor’s eye.</p>
</li>
</ul>
<p>Remember: your website isn’t just a digital flyer - it’s a business tool.</p>
<h2 id="heading-2-writing-content-thats-all-about-you"><strong>2. Writing Content That’s All About You</strong></h2>
<p>Many businesses fall into the trap of “me-first” content. While your story is important, what visitors really care about is how you can solve <em>their</em> problem.</p>
<p>Fix this by:</p>
<ul>
<li><p>Speaking directly to your ideal customer’s challenges.</p>
</li>
<li><p>Highlighting benefits over features.</p>
</li>
<li><p>Using simple, everyday language that connects.</p>
</li>
</ul>
<p>Instead of: “We are the best roofing company in town.” Try: “Tired of roof leaks during the rain? We’ll fix it fast - without breaking the bank.”</p>
<h2 id="heading-3-no-clear-call-to-action-cta"><strong>3. No Clear Call-to-Action (CTA)</strong></h2>
<p>Your visitors shouldn’t have to guess what to do next.</p>
<p>Common missing CTAs:</p>
<ul>
<li><p>“Get a quote”</p>
</li>
<li><p>“Book a free call”</p>
</li>
<li><p>“See our work”</p>
</li>
</ul>
<p>Place your CTA:</p>
<ul>
<li><p>Above the fold (the first thing people see)</p>
</li>
<li><p>At the bottom of every page</p>
</li>
<li><p>On contact and service pages</p>
</li>
</ul>
<p>A great CTA turns a curious visitor into a real customer.</p>

<h2 id="heading-5-ignoring-seo-basics"><strong>5. Ignoring SEO Basics</strong></h2>
<p>You built your site… but no one is visiting. Why?</p>
<p>Because Google doesn’t know you exist.</p>
<p>Basic SEO steps every site needs:</p>
<ul>
<li><p>Title tags and meta descriptions</p>
</li>
<li><p>Proper heading structure (H1, H2, H3…)</p>
</li>
<li><p>Alt text on images</p>
</li>
<li><p>Sitemap submission</p>
</li>
</ul>
<p>These help your website show up when someone searches for “website design for company” or your specific service or product locally like “Best &lt;product name&gt; near me”.</p>
<h2 id="heading-6-skipping-mobile-optimization"><strong>6. Skipping Mobile Optimization</strong></h2>
<p>Over 60% of website traffic comes from mobile devices. If your site doesn’t load fast or look good on a phone, people bounce.</p>
<p>What you need:</p>
<ul>
<li><p>Responsive design that adapts to all screen sizes</p>
</li>
<li><p>Clickable buttons and readable fonts</p>
</li>
<li><p>Fast-loading pages</p>
</li>
</ul>
<p>If you’re not sure how your site performs, test it on different devices (or use Google’s Mobile-Friendly Test).</p>
<h2 id="heading-7-launching-without-tracking-tools"><strong>7. Launching Without Tracking Tools</strong></h2>
<p>You can’t improve what you don’t measure.</p>
<p>Without analytics, you don’t know:</p>
<ul>
<li><p>How people find your site</p>
</li>
<li><p>What pages they visit most</p>
</li>
<li><p>Where they drop off</p>
</li>
</ul>
<p>Free tools like Google Analytics and Hotjar give you this insight so you can tweak your site over time.</p>

<h3 id="heading-2-layout-that-converts-from-first-impression-to-final-click">2. Layout That Converts: From First Impression to Final Click</h3>
<p>Your layout is your silent salesperson. It guides attention and decision-making without a single word. Here’s the flow that works:</p>
<p><strong>Above the Fold</strong></p>
<ul>
<li><p>Clear headline that speaks to a pain point or benefit</p>
</li>
<li><p>Short subtext that explains how you help</p>
</li>
<li><p>A single, strong CTA button</p>
</li>
</ul>
<p><strong>Middle Sections</strong></p>
<ul>
<li><p>Bulletproof benefits: Why you’re different</p>
</li>
<li><p>How it works (keep it simple)</p>
</li>
<li><p>Testimonials or reviews for trust</p>
</li>
</ul>
<p><strong>Bottom of Page</strong></p>
<ul>
<li><p>Another CTA (don’t make them scroll back up)</p>
</li>
<li><p>Social proof badges, policies, or FAQs for reassurance</p>
</li>
</ul>
<p>This isn’t design fluff. This is <strong>strategic layout</strong> for sales.</p>
<h3 id="heading-3-website-copywriting-tips-that-actually-convert-in-2025">3. Website Copywriting Tips That Actually Convert in 2025</h3>
<p>Words are your 24/7 salesperson. Great design catches the eye, but <strong>great copy keeps the visitor reading</strong>.</p>
<p>Here’s how to write words that convert:</p>
<ul>
<li><p>Talk about the <strong>visitor</strong>, not yourself. Replace "we" with "you."</p>
</li>
<li><p>Lead with the <strong>problem</strong>. Then offer the <strong>solution</strong>.</p>
</li>
<li><p>Use <strong>emotional triggers</strong>: clarity, relief, speed, results.</p>
</li>
<li><p>Use proven formulas like <strong>PAS (Problem, Agitation, Solution)</strong> or <strong>AIDA (Attention, Interest, Desire, Action)</strong>.</p>
</li>
</ul>
<p><strong>Example:</strong></p>
<blockquote>
<p>"We build websites for small businesses" → Too generic. "Struggling to get leads from your website? We build pages that actually convert."</p>
</blockquote>
<p>Now you’re talking.</p>
<h3 id="heading-4-call-to-action-the-make-or-break-moment">4. Call-to-Action: The Make-or-Break Moment</h3>
<p>The CTA is the conversion trigger. It should be everywhere, and it should feel effortless.</p>
<p><strong>What makes a great CTA?</strong></p>
<ul>
<li><p>One clear action (not 5)</p>
</li>
<li><p>Benefit-driven copy ("Book Free Call" &gt; "Submit")</p>
</li>
<li><p>Low risk/high value offer</p>
</li>
</ul>
<p><strong>Placement matters too:</strong></p>
<ul>
<li><p>Above the fold</p>
</li>
<li><p>After benefits</p>
</li>
<li><p>Bottom of page</p>
</li>
</ul>
<p><strong>Quick tip:</strong> A/B test different CTA styles to see what works best. Sometimes a color change boosts clicks by 20%.</p>
